It's official: Dawkins signs 5 year deal with Broncos

If this is what it would have taken to keep Brian Dawkins in Philly, maybe the Eagles were smart to let him go. Dawkins has officially signed with the Broncos, getting a 5 year, 17 million dollar deal. According to Adam Schefter of NFL Network, the deal could be worth as much as 27 million over the 5 years and it could also be reduced to 2 years, 9 million.

Really, Denver, 5 years? There is no way that the 35 year old Dawkins will be playing for 5 more seasons, so this deal is probably really just for the 2 year minimum. B-Dawk should be a solid player and a great leader over those 2 years.

The Eagles have now officially lost their heart and soul. The only positive to come from this move is they will now get signicantly younger on defense. The Birds are still way under the cap so it will be interesting to see what they do next to plug some of their holes.
